Loswaith Posted August 5, 2014 Share Posted August 5, 2014 The bigger thing I find an issue is, is that for some warframes it is actually cheaper to buy and build the prime version than outright buying the normal version.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Lorthos_Mornin Posted August 5, 2014 Share Posted August 5, 2014 (edited) The bigger thing I find an issue is, is that for some warframes it is actually cheaper to buy and build the prime version than outright buying the normal version. Hmmm...that does seem an issue. Player market and the number of prime pieces sitting around drove the prices of prime frames into the ground. However, you're still going to have to wait the 3.5 days for the frame to build and it doesn't come with a potato like the ones from the market, so I guess time saved and the pre-installed potato is where the cost is coming from. Mostly time saved, especially if you count how long it would take to get x planet and farm all those parts normally.
